Object-Oriented Analysis and Design for Information Systems

Object-Oriented Analysis and Design for Information Systems : Modeling with UML, OCL, and IFML

4.5 (4 ratings by Goodreads)

Free delivery worldwide

Available. Dispatched from the UK in 3 business days
When will my order arrive?

Description

Object-Oriented Analysis and Design for Information Systems clearly explains real object-oriented programming in practice. Expert author Raul Sidnei Wazlawick explains concepts such as object responsibility, visibility and the real need for delegation in detail. The object-oriented code generated by using these concepts in a systematic way is concise, organized and reusable.

The patterns and solutions presented in this book are based in research and industrial applications. You will come away with clarity regarding processes and use cases and a clear understand of how to expand a use case. Wazlawick clearly explains clearly how to build meaningful sequence diagrams. Object-Oriented Analysis and Design for Information Systems illustrates how and why building a class model is not just placing classes into a diagram. You will learn the necessary organizational patterns so that your software architecture will be maintainable.
show more

Product details

  • Paperback | 376 pages
  • 188 x 232 x 26mm | 779.99g
  • Morgan Kaufmann Publishers In
  • San Francisco, United States
  • English
  • black & white illustrations, black & white tables, figures
  • 0124186734
  • 9780124186736
  • 899,298

Table of contents

Introduction
Business Modeling
High-Level Requirements
Use Case Based Project Planning (Online Chapter)
Expanded Use Cases
Conceptual Modeling: Fundamentals
Conceptual Modeling: Patterns
Functional Modeling with OCL Contracts
Domain Tier Design
Code Generation (Online Chapter)
Testing
Interface Tier Design with IFML
Data Persistence (Online Chapter)
show more

About Raul Sidnei Wazlawick

Raul Sidnei Wazlawick - Possui Bacharelado em Ciencia da Computacao pela Universidade Federal de Santa Catarina (UFSC, 1988), Mestrado em Ciencia da Computacao pela Universidade Federal do Rio Grande do Sul (UFRGS, 1990), Doutorado em Engenharia de Producao (UFSC, 1993) e Pos-Doutorado pela Universidade Nova de Lisboa (UNL, 1998). E Professor Titular da UFSC, tendo sido contratado em 1992. Ministra "Engenharia de Software II" e "Informatica e Sociedade" no Bacharelado em Ciencia da Computacao e "Modelagem Orientada a Objetos" no Mestrado/Doutorado em Ciencia da Computacao. Na UFSC ocupou os seguintes cargos: Coordenador do Bacharelado em Ciencia da Computacao, Coordenador do Programa de Pos-Graduacao (Mestrado) em Ciencia da Computacao, Conselheiro da Camara de Pos-Graduacao e Diretor Academico do Campus de Ararangua. Na Sociedade Brasileira de Computacao (SBC) foi Conselheiro Suplente por quatro mandatos e Conselheiro Titular por um mandato, alem de Coordenador do Comite Especial de Informatica na Educacao entre 1995 e 1997. Criou e foi editor da Revista Brasileira de Informatica na Educacao da SBC entre 1997 e 2001. Na International Federation for Information Processing (IFIP) foi representante do Brasil no Comite Tecnico de Educacao (TC3) por 11 anos e Chair do Working Group on ICT and Higher Education (WG3.2) por 2 anos. Coordenou varios eventos nacionais e internacionais, incluindo o Congresso da SBC (2002), Simposio Brasileiro de Engenharia de Software (SBES, 2006) e, juntamente com Rosa Maria Vicari, a IX IFIP World Conference on Computers in Education (2009). E autor dos seguintes livros: "Analise e Projeto de Sistemas de Informacao Orientados a Objetos", (Elsevier, 2004; 2* edicao em 2011; 3* edicao em 2015) "Metodologia de Pesquisa para Ciencia da Computacao" (Elsevier, 2009; 2* edicao em 2014), "Engenharia de Software: Conceitos e Praticas" (Elsevier, 2012) e "Object-Oriented Analysis and Design for Information Systems: Modeling with UML, OCL, and IFML" (Morgan Kaufman, 2014). Tem experiencia na area de Engenharia de Software, atuando principalmente em modelagem de sistemas orientados a objetos e melhoria do processo de desenvolvimento de software. No Ministerio da Educacao (MEC) foi membro do Comite de Especialistas de Ensino em Ciencia da Computacao (CEEInf) por 4 anos e e atualmente membro da Comissao Assessora da Area de Sistemas de Informacao para o ENADE. E Supervisor Geral do Projeto e-SUS, parceria da UFSC com o Ministerio da Saude para a reestruturacao do sistema de informacao da atencao basica (Postos de Saude) no Brasil. Recebeu, juntamente com sua orientanda Marilia Guterres Ferreira, o premio Best Paper Award na Conferencia Iberoamericana de Engenharia de Software em 2011. Em 2013 recebeu o titulo de "Professor Honoris Causa" pelo Centro de Instrucao de Guerra Eletronica do Exercito Brasileiro.
show more

Rating details

4 ratings
4.5 out of 5 stars
5 50% (2)
4 50% (2)
3 0% (0)
2 0% (0)
1 0% (0)
Book ratings by Goodreads
Goodreads is the world's largest site for readers with over 50 million reviews. We're featuring millions of their reader ratings on our book pages to help you find your new favourite book. Close X